    How to roundup the amount to next ten ruppes in excel

    Dear Friends,

    I request you all kindly let me know the forumal where we can roundup the value to next rupees.

    I have tried Roundup and MRound functions to get the result but I did nto get the appropreiate resut which I am looking for.

    For example if I need to deduct Tax Rs. 801 to a particualrs person I wanted to add another 9 rupees with a result it should be 810/-

    next one if it is 903/- it has to be 910/-

    if it is 204/- it has to be 210/-

    if it is 505/- it has to 510/-

    Re: How to roundup the amount to next ten ruppes in excel

    =ROUNDUP(a1/10,0)*10
